When designing a layout, should we consider content first or design first? I make websites and 99% of the time my client wants the design before they start thinking about the content. In these cases, I use lorem ipsum text as content during the design.
Would it be helpful to get the content before starting the design? I think that having the content would be helpful for making some design desicions, but the client always wants to think about the content after the design, which can lead to disruption in the layout.
Example: In one part of the design, I use a single line heading, which fits the lorem ipsum text. The client decides (after the design) that the content of this heading should be something which is a lot longer, and takes up a couple lines, disrupting the layout.
Is it generally considered better to design a layout first, or to get the content and design the layout based on the content?
